The Quickfind autocomplete index on Harborlight has been sluggish lately — queries over 150 ms usually mean the suggester shards need a warm-up call after deploys. Hit the /v2/suggest/warm endpoint once per region and latency drops back to normal. It's idempotent, so don't worry about double-firing. To call it, authenticate with the internal key below.

app token of yajeg-kawef = kto11_7En3XSX8xQw

# Break-Glass: Catalog Cache Invalidation

Scope: the Pinrow product catalog at Veldstone Retail. If stale prices persist after a purge and the Hollowmere invalidation queue is wedged, use break-glass to flush the edge tier directly. Contractors: get verbal sign-off from the catalog lead first. Steps: open the Hollowmere admin shell, select emergency-flush, confirm the tenant, and run it once — repeated flushes thrash the origin. Access is logged and expires after 20 minutes. Unseal the admin shell with the passphrase below.

recovery phrase for kahop-tajog: istix-casvan

Handover — tailctl ownership

Mira, taking over tailctl from me as of Friday. Key points: plugin authors hit the v2 streaming endpoint, not v1 — v1 silently drops multiline entries. The --since flag parses durations only, no timestamps yet; patch is half-done in my branch. Rate limits are per-token, 200 streams. Release cadence is biweekly, cut from main. Don't touch the Fenwick adapter, it's frozen pending the Ostrel migration. Everything else, including auth setup for plugin devs, is documented here.

dashboard of kahap-yajof = https://superset.qirvanforge.internal/ticket/deploy/secrets/view/repo/projects/browse/b82fa9fa5da23b3020149682

**Ticket: Rounding drift in FX conversion (prod-eu)**

Heads up for future maintainers: the Centavo service was rounding twice — once in the converter and once in the ledger writer — which produced off-by-a-cent totals on multi-leg conversions. Root cause was CENTAVO_ROUND_MODE missing from the prod-eu env file, so it defaulted to `half-up` instead of `banker`. Fix is to add the mode explicitly and redeploy. While editing that file, note the rates-provider credential belongs on the very next line.

env line for fafof-fahag: LEDGER_TOKEN5=f8790